Reliance Entertainment’s WWO Appoints Prabhat Choudhary As Business Head

World Wide Open (WWO), a digital marketing agency specializing in social media marketing and media buying for the film industry on behalf of Reliance Entertainment has roped in Prabhat Choudhary as its head. Choudhary is the founder of Spice PR, and the co-owner of the celebrity digital marketing agency, Entropy. “At WWO, Prabhat will take forward the mantle of enhancing digital innovations, multi-platform reach, driving strategic partnerships and developing the media and entertainment client portfolio,” the company said in a statement.

Over the years, WWO has worked on digital campaigns of films like ‘Simmba’, ‘Golmaal Again’, ‘Veere Di Wedding’, ‘Super 30’, ‘Dear Zindagi’, ‘Jab Harry Met Sejal’, ‘ Saand Ki Aankh’, ‘Rabta’, ‘Stree’, ‘Half Girlfriend’, ‘Parmanu’, and more.  Besides being an agency on board for Reliance Entertainment, WWO has serviced production houses like Red Chillies Entertainment, Balaji Motion Pictures Limited, Maddock Films, Color Yellow, Sony Music India etc.

“The agency is equipped to provide end-to-end digital marketing solutions including creative strategy, creation of media assets and inventory planning and buying and digital media planning and buying,” the statement said. In 2017, WWO was named the ‘Agency of the Year’ at the Asia Pacific Customer Engagement Forum and Awards (ACEF). In 2019, the agency won the award for Best Interactive Piece of Content at Digies for the film, ‘Game Over’.

“WWO, known for its innovative marketing, launched the first-ever Target AR Filter in India and Bollywood, in print, for the film, ‘Super 30’,” it further said.

Reliance Entertainment is the media and entertainment arm of Reliance Group and is engaged in the creation and distribution of content across film, television, digital and gaming platforms.―Business World
